In P51-zeke's test, they just did a shallow dive and then zoomed up. The zoom's beginning speed must be lower than 325PMH IAS.
At first, they zoomed up from cruising speed,that was 210MPH IAS=250MPH TAS, when P51d reach 130MPH=150MPH TAS, zeke was 90m lower. So how much kinetic energy was spent to get altitude?
0.5(250^2-150^2)= 20000
If they begin from 325MPH IAS=389MPH TAS
0.5(389^2-150^2)= 64410
We assume that there is a linear relationship between "kinetic energy" and P51D's zoom advantge to "damaged" zeke52.
So this time, p51d should be 3.22*90=290metres higher.
That is to say, when p51d @325MPH IAS@10000ft, and find a (lightly damaged) zeke on his 6 with same altitude and speed. And the distant between them are 450 metres. P51D may try a zoom, and will probably (450+290)=740m higher than zeke when p51d's speed drops to130 MPH IAS.
Surely 740m is enough for avioding being hit by zeke's cannon.
